A Smarter Way to Build a Field Constructed PV System on Flat Roofs

In the Italian market, a field constructed PV system often lives or dies by what happens on site: tight schedules, variable roof conditions, and the constant risk of leaks from roof penetrations. For installers and designers working on flat roofs, the priority is clear—deliver a photovoltaic array that is fast to assemble, mechanically stable, and easy to certify. That’s why ballasted mounting solutions have become a preferred approach for many commercial and industrial rooftops. Concrete ballast supports allow you to position modules without drilling the membrane, reducing waterproofing risks and simplifying the construction sequence. Fewer components mean fewer installation errors, quicker logistics, and more predictable labor time. From a design perspective, a well-engineered racking concept helps manage wind uplift, distributed loads, and module orientation while keeping the layout clean and serviceable. If your goal is to deploy a field constructed PV system that performs reliably over time, the mounting strategy is not a detail—it is the foundation of safety, speed, and long-term O&M efficiency.

Speed on Site, Less Complexity, Fewer Roof Risks

For PV installers, the biggest advantage of a ballasted structure is installation speed: align the supports, place the modules, and complete the electrical work with minimal interruptions. No penetrations typically translate into fewer approvals and less coordination with roofing contractors, especially on sensitive membranes. The result is a smoother workflow and fewer surprises in the field. For engineers and technical offices, the value is in dependable data for sizing: wind calculations, load checks, and verified configurations that reduce design responsibility and uncertainty. A field constructed PV system should be easy to replicate across multiple sites, and standardised ballast elements help create repeatable outcomes.
